About this listen

The critically acclaimed novel from a master of contemporary American fiction - now available as an ebook.

A story of genius, performance, and the psychological forces that drive the competitive spirit.

Brian Stoppard is blessed with prodigious natural talents. Howard Cohen, less so. Starting in middle school in New York, Howard watches Brian effortlessly win at everything he tries: He’s a natural chess champion, a perfect athlete, a brilliant student. As the two move through life as friends and competitors, Brian’s easy success is a constant source of envy, awe, and inspiration for the ambitious but less-gifted Howard.

Told with great humor and style, The Game Player is a story of those born to greatness and those who must strive for it.
